The recipients — Tomarey Henry and Bertrand Gray — who excelled in the 2025 Grade 6 National Assessment, also demonstrated exemplary conduct during the RPFAB’s Youth Intervention Program.
Speaking after the ceremony, ACP Jeffers said that he initially wanted to remain anonymous, and that the donations were about investing in youth and not for personal recognition.
Gray placed second overall for Greenbay Primary in the Grade 6 National Assessment.
Because, you know, everybody believed that nothing good can come out of Greenbay; that’s not true.
I believe that if we identify youth and invest in them, they will become good children and become leaders of tomorrow.”Jeffers emphasized that investment goes beyond financial support.
